Job description

We are seeking a Structural Analysis Engineer to join our engineering team supporting the design, certification, and lifecycle support of advanced aerospace products. The successful candidate will perform structural analysis to verify the integrity, safety, and regulatory compliance of aircraft structures while collaborating with cross-functional engineering, manufacturing, and product support teams throughout the product lifecycle.

Key Responsibilities

       Perform structural analysis to evaluate aircraft components and assemblies for strength, durability, and regulatory compliance.

       Conduct finite element modeling (FEA), static stress, fatigue and damage tolerance, thermal, vibration, and structural analyses.

       Develop analytical models and engineering calculations to validate structural designs.

       Support structural sizing and optimization for metallic and composite structures.

       Prepare stress reports, substantiation reports, and technical documentation.

       Collaborate with Design, Manufacturing, Quality, Certification, and Product Support teams.

       Support design reviews, testing, troubleshooting, and post-delivery engineering activities.

       Ensure compliance with customer requirements and applicable aerospace regulations.

Requirements

       Bachelor's degree in Aerospace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, or related engineering discipline.

       5-8 years of experience with a BS, 3-6 years with an MS, or 0-3 years with a PhD.

       Knowledge of mechanics of materials, aircraft structures, and finite element modeling.

       Experience with static, fatigue, and damage tolerance analysis.

       Strong analytical, problem-solving, and communication skills.

Preferred Qualifications

       Aerospace industry experience.

       Experience supporting aircraft certification programs.

       Knowledge of FAA/EASA regulations.

       Experience with metallic and composite structures.

       Proficiency with Nastran, Patran, HyperMesh, ANSYS, Abaqus, CATIA V5, or Siemens NX.
